ok so all's well that ends well or something similar, except that it's
not...

I of course want to let users search the db.. but I want to let them narrow
it down only as far as they want to... so if they wall all the verses in
Romans 8, let them have it..

<cfquery name='searchbible' datasource='thebible'>
Select 
    Book, chapter, verse, textdata from #table# (kjv or AmericanStandard)
Where
    Book='#book#' and Chapter='#chapter#' and verse='#verse#'
</cfquery>

<cfoutput>
.....
</cfoutput>

The problem is that if I specify book, chapter, and verse, it nails it, but
if i don't specify any one of them, it errors out.. and i don't even know
how to go about searching textdata for a word or phrase..
